Lot 2460

1874-S $10 Liberty. NGC graded AU-55. Nice golden toning on both sides. Only 10,000 struck. A much lustrous coin and a scarce date by any benchmark. What's more, this has an engaging display of natural toning that spreads evenly across the warm golden surfaces. The strike is strong for 1874-S, with just a touch of shallowness in LIBERTY and the hair above and below the coronet. Some might object to calling the coin sensational, but all the same it is outstanding in light of the very few specimens graded by NGC. Pop 6; 4 finer in 58. (PCGS # 8671) .
Estimated Value $5,000 - 5,500.

 
Realized $5,750
